Question Where to start with performance upgrade 6.0

I have a stock 2006 F-350 dual rear wheel 4X4 crew cab with auto with a 6.0.....where should I start with performance up-grades. I don't want to go overboard....but would like to get some advanced horsepower for everyday driving. where should I start....I would like to add an Edge Juice...what do I need to install before that. I would go gauges, exhaust and then a custom tuned SCT in that order. I would not recommend the Edge.

The list gets a lot more in depth if you want to do more than just a tuner.

id do guages, your stock intake flows enough air for about 500 hp...as for tuning...stay away from edge, it doesnt tune your transmission and will hurt it...get an SCT tuner with CUSTOM tunes...there are vendors that sell the tuners on here and the tuning you have a few choices..Eric @ Innovative, Matt @ Gearhead, Cale @ BTS...i think a few others im forgetting

exhaust, gauges,egr delete, intake, arp studs, sct custom tunes-in that order, or have egr done with studs. will have less headaches and better reliability.
